Benefits Reduce response time for client request Reduce traffic on an institution’s access link. Internet dense with caches enables “poor” content providers to effectively deliver content
Drawbacks?
Latency –Cooperative caching = even greater latency Cost of deploying proxy server Stale data

CDNs vs. Caching?
Different business models –CDNs = no infrastructure required for client CDNs use push model to keep data fresh CDNs don’t incur latency of cache miss
